/**
* `main.c' - murmurhash
*
* copyright (c) 2014-2025 joseph werle <[email protected]>
*/
#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<unistd.h>
#include <inttypes.h>
#include "murmurhash.h"
#define hash(key) murmurhash(key, (uint32_t) strlen(key), (uint32_t) atoi(seed));
#define isopt(opt, str) (0 == strncmp(opt, str, strlen(str)))
#define setopt(opt, key, var) { \
size_t len = strlen(key) + 1; \
for (int i = 0; i < len; ++i) { (*opt)++; } \
var = opt; \
}
static void usage () {
fprintf(stderr, "usage: murmur [-hV] [options]\n");
}
static void help () {
fprintf(stderr, "\noptions:\n");
fprintf(stderr, "\n --seed=[seed] hash seed (optional)");
fprintf(stderr, "\n");
}
static char* read_stdin () {
size_t bsize = 1024;
size_t size = 1;
char buf[bsize];
char *res = (char *) malloc(sizeof(char) * bsize);
char *tmp = NULL;
// memory issue
if (NULL == res) { return NULL; }
// cap
res[0] = '\0';
// read
if (NULL != fgets(buf, bsize, stdin)) {
// store
tmp = res;
// resize
size += (size_t) strlen(buf);
// realloc
res = (char *) realloc(res, size);
// memory issues
if (NULL == res) {
free(tmp);
return NULL;
}
// yield
strcat(res, buf);
return res;
}
free(res);
return NULL;
}
int main (int argc, char** argv) {
char* buf = NULL;
char* key = NULL;
char* seed = NULL;
uint32_t h = 0;
// parse opts
do {
char* opt = NULL;
opt = *argv++; // unused
while ((opt = *argv++)) {
// flags
if ('-' == *opt++) {
switch (*opt++) {
case 'h':
return usage(), help(), 0;
case 'V':
fprintf(stderr, "%s\n", MURMURHASH_VERSION);
return 0;
case '-':
if (isopt(opt, "seed")) {
setopt(opt, "seed", seed);
}
break;
default:
(*opt)--;
// error
fprintf(stderr, "unknown option: `%s'\n", opt);
usage();
return 1;
}
}
}
} while (0);
if (NULL == seed) {
seed = "0";
}
if (1 == isatty(0)) { return 1; }
else if (ferror(stdin)) { return 1; }
else {
buf = read_stdin();
if (NULL == buf) { return 1; }
else if (0 == strlen(buf)) { buf = ""; }
h = hash(buf);
printf("%" PRIu32 "\n", h);
do {
key = read_stdin();
if (NULL == key) { break; }
else if (0 == strlen(buf)) { buf = ""; }
h = hash(buf);
printf("%d" PRIu32 "\n", h);
} while (NULL != key);
}
return 0;
}
